Selecting the Ideal Metal Roof Coating for Long-Lasting Protection
Identifying the most suitable coating for your metal roof is essential for optimizing longevity and performance. Various variables influence this determination, including surrounding conditions, the slope of the roof, and specific building requirements. Superior solutions, such as silicone, acrylic, or polyurethane, offer distinct qualities. Silicone coatings deliver superior waterproofing and UV resistance, rendering them perfect for areas with heavy rainfall. Acrylic coatings are recognized for their energy efficiency and reflectivity, which can lower cooling expenses. Polyurethane options provide outstanding resistance to wear and durability, well-suited to high-traffic areas.
Additionally, adequate surface preparation is essential for adhesion and long-lasting performance. It is advisable to select coatings with a well-established reputation in commercial roofing applications. Confirming compatibility with the existing roofing system will also enhance the lifespan of the roof. Ultimately, the most suitable option will correspond to particular environmental factors and performance standards, ensuring a durable, cost-effective solution for commercial metal roofing systems.

Benefits of Acrylic Coatings
Acrylic coatings offer numerous advantages that make them a popular choice for commercial roofing applications. A key advantage is their superior UV resistance, which helps maintain the roof's durability and aesthetics over time. These coatings are water-based, making them green-conscious and straightforward to apply. In addition, acrylic coatings are highly flexible, enabling them to expand and contract with changing temperatures without cracking. Their affordability also contributes to their appeal, providing effective protection without breaking the budget. Moreover, acrylic coatings are found in multiple color options, allowing property owners to improve appearance while ensuring functional performance. Together, these characteristics make acrylic coatings as a dependable choice for those seeking durable and efficient metal roof solutions.
Advantages of Silicone Coatings
There are many reasons why silicone coatings an ideal solution for commercial metal roofs. They deliver superior resistance to ultraviolet rays and harsh weather, prolonging the life of the roofing system. This flexibility supports effective expansion and contraction, minimizing the risk of cracking. Furthermore, silicone coatings are remarkably reflective, contributing to energy efficiency through reduced cooling demands. Such coatings also exhibit excellent adhesion properties, providing a reliable connection to the metal surface. Furthermore, silicone coatings are resistant to mold and mildew, thereby improving indoor air quality. Routine maintenance is streamlined, as they can be cleaned and recoated with ease. All things considered, silicone coatings deliver a robust and affordable method for protecting commercial metal roofs against environmental challenges.

Surface Preparation Fundamentals
Effective surface preparation is essential for ensuring the effective application of roof coatings. This process begins with a thorough inspection to identify any damage, rust, or debris on the metal roof. Surface cleaning is essential; employing a pressure washer or suitable cleaning solution eliminates dirt, grease, and old coatings that could compromise adhesion. Following the cleaning process, the roof should be left to dry entirely. Subsequently, treating any rust spots with an appropriate rust-inhibiting primer aids in preventing further deterioration. Additionally, repairs to any seams or flashing should be conducted to guarantee a uniform surface. Finally, confirming that the surface is free from moisture and contaminants will enhance the longevity and effectiveness of the applied roof coatings.
Application Techniques Overview
Successfully performing the roof coating application process demands a systematic approach to guarantee peak performance and longevity. First, confirm that the surface is clear of contaminants, dry, and clean, as this promotes adhesion. Next, identify the suitable coating type based on the particular requirements of the metal roof. It is advisable to use a primer if needed, improving the adhesion process. When applying the coating, use consistent strokes with a brush, roller, or sprayer, making sure the coating is evenly distributed. Focus particularly on seams and edges, where leaks are most prone to develop. Multiple thin coats are generally recommended over a single thick coat, as they promote superior adhesion and more effective drying. Lastly, ensure that all safety precautions are followed throughout the application process.
Curing and Drying Procedure
Curing and drying are fundamental steps in the process of applying roof coatings, affecting both longevity and performance. In the curing phase, chemical interactions develop that attach the coating to the surface, enhancing adhesion and resistance to environmental factors. This phase generally demands optimal temperature and humidity conditions, which must be carefully observed to ensure adequate curing.
Evaporation, on the other hand, refers to the vaporization of solvents, allowing the application to cure. Variables such as ventilation, coating thickness, and environmental conditions can considerably affect drying time. It is important to avoid moisture exposure or foot traffic during each stage to avoid imperfections. Observing the manufacturer's recommendations ensures the lasting quality and efficiency of the coating on the roof.
Maintenance Tips to Extend Your Metal Roof Coating's Life
Preserving a metal roof coating is vital for extending its performance and lifespan. Periodic inspections serve a critical purpose; homeowners should watch for indicators of deterioration, such as cracking, peeling, or discoloration. Cleaning the surface periodically helps prevent the buildup of dirt and debris, which can retain moisture and cause corrosion. Using a gentle pressure wash or soft brush with mild detergent is recommended for effective cleaning without damaging the coating.
